AC electronic loads support up to 1250 Vdc and 350 Vrms AC. You use them to test AC sources, inverters, UPS systems, and grid tied equipment. Regenerative and unidirectional models give flexibility and reduce energy loss.

DC electronic loads support batteries, power supplies, DC DC converters, fuel cells, and inverters. The EA ELR Series delivers 1.5 kW to 30 kW per chassis and scales up to 3.84 MW. Energy recovery reaches >96% energy, reducing heat, noise, and HVAC costs..

An electronic load is used to simulate real electrical loads for testing batteries, power supplies, inverters, and EV systems in R&D, production, and validation environments.

AC electronic loads test AC equipment like UPS and inverters, while DC electronic loads are used for batteries, DC power supplies, and EV components.

Regenerative electronic loads return energy to the grid, reducing electricity costs, heat generation, and cooling requirements—ideal for high-power testing in India.
